Electrical power is measured in watts. In an electrical system power (P) is equal to the voltage multiplied by the current.P = VxI Watts = Volts x Amps.
In the United States the maximum output of an FM station is 100,000 watts. Some older "grandfathered" stations transmit at higher power levels, such as WBCT in Grand Rapids, Michigan (320,000 watts). http://www.fcc.gov/mb/audio/fmclasses.html

Electrical power is expressed in watts or in jouls per secondAnother AnswerThere is no such thing as 'electrical power'. Power is simply a rate: the rate of doing work. Power can be measured in watts (in the SI system) or in horsepower (in the Imperial system). There is no reason why the power of a heater can't be measured in horsepower or the power of a car can't be measured in watts.
